addAllMappers<T extends ExitCodeExceptionHandler> method

void addAllMappers<T extends ExitCodeExceptionHandler>(
  1. Throwable exception,
  2. Iterable<T> mappers
)

Adds a collection of ExitCodeExceptionHandlers for a given exception.

Each mapper is wrapped in a _MappedExitCodeGenerator internally.

Example:

generators.addAllMappers(
  AppException(),
  [MyMapper()],
);

Implementation

void addAllMappers<T extends ExitCodeExceptionHandler>(Throwable exception, Iterable<T> mappers) {
  for (T mapper in mappers) {
    add(exception, mapper);
  }
}